Student Conduct and Conflict Resolution (SCCR), within the Dean of Students Office, provides a process focused on accountability, development, and support of those involved or impacted by violations of University of Florida regulations. This is achieved through an educational and restorative lens that encourages civility, upholds the integrity of institutionally awarded degrees, and helps promote the safety of the University Community.The Program Coordinator in Student Conduct and Conflict Resolution (SCCR) is responsible for supporting the daily functions of the office by providing essential administrative and operational support. This role assists with managing daily communications, organizing case materials, supporting staff workflows, and ensuring accurate recordkeeping in the university’s case management system.

Job Description:

Case and Documentation Support

  • Make charging decisions on incoming reports, create and manage records within the student conduct database, assign cases, create/send case correspondence.
  • Coordinate case completion for Student Conduct and Conflict Resolution. This may include evaluating submitted documentation, updating records and running reports within the student conduct database, sending correspondence related to case status, and placing service indicator holds on student accounts.
  • Maintain accurate organization of case files using established office procedures.
  • Add case notes based on provided information and ensure data is complete and accurate.

Communication and Administrative Support

  • Serve as the primary reviewer of the SCCR email inbox and triage communications based on urgency and content.
  • Respond to general inquiries by phone or email and forward messages to appropriate staff.
  • Conduct outreach to campus departments to schedule meetings or gather needed information.
  • Coordinate and schedule administrative meetings, investigations, and hearings for SCCR staff.
  • Assist with the coordination of hearings by scheduling meetings, admitting and removing participants via Zoom, and ensuring smooth logistical support as needed.

Process Management

  • Manage the record overlay and service indicator processes for all cases.
  • Coordinate the dean certification process for students applying to graduate and/or professional schools, study abroad programs, and other positions or institutions requiring conduct history verification. Respond to reference checks from various agencies.
  • Oversee and provide direction to student assistants in their office administrative duties
